- Migrant Labor Housing (Agricultural Labor Camps) Licensing
The agricultural industry employs a substantial number of migrant farm workers in planting, cultivating, harvesting, and packaging of the many labor-intensive crops grown in Michigan. Good housing is an essential element in securing an adequate supply of seasonal agricultural workers. Migrant housing exists throughout the Lower Peninsula of Michigan, at approximately 900 licensed housing sites, including 4,500 living units with a capacity for 25,000 persons.
